Ethereum Plummets Below $3,450 Amid Crypto Market Decline, Drops 5.04% in 24 Hours
Main Idea
Ethereum's price dropped below $3,450 on August 3rd, experiencing a 5.04% decline within 24 hours due to sustained selling pressure and broader crypto market downturn.
Key Points
1. Ethereum fell below the $3,450 mark amid a continuing market downturn, with a 24-hour price drop of 5.04%.
2. The decline was driven by sustained selling pressure across the crypto market, reflecting investor caution amid macroeconomic uncertainty.
3. The overall crypto market experienced a downward trend on August 3rd, influencing Ethereum’s price and contributing to a risk-off sentiment among traders.
4. Key metrics show Ethereum's price at $3,445, market cap at $415 billion (a 3.8% decrease since July 31), and 24-hour trading volume at $18 billion (stable compared to the previous day).
